I've been working at adding two seat sections to the rear of my '75 710M radio truck for a while. I purchased two frame sections from SAV but needed cushions. Andre at Fat Fabrications came to the rescue with some fantastic replacement cushions in OD green Cordura (although other colors are available). I finally got around to installing them and think they look great. The quality is first rate and couldn't be more pleased. If you're in need of replacement cushions and don't have the time or inclination to fabricate your own, you won't go wrong with Andre.
